Prok2

Developmental stage

Expressed in mid-late pachytene spermatocytes at the stages VII, VIII and IX of the semiferous epithelial cycle.

Function

May function as an output molecule from the suprachiasmatic nucleus (SCN) that transmits behavioral circadian rhythm. May also function locally within the SCN to synchronize output. Potently contracts gastrointestinal (GI) smooth muscle (By similarity).

Sequence Similarities

Belongs to the AVIT (prokineticin) family.

Tissue Specificity

Expressed in the SCN and among a few other discrete brain areas, including the islands of Calleja, media l preoptic area of the hypothalamus and the shell of the nucleus accumbens. Highly expressed in testis. In the SCN, expression subjected to high amplitude of circadian oscillation.
